JPMorgan's Dimon says U.S. banks healthy, Europe lagging

PARIS (Reuters) - European banks are still lagging behind the U.S. banking industry, which has almost completely recovered from the global financial crisis, Jamie Dimon, chief executive of JPMorgan Chase & Co , told French newspaper Les Echos.
